随着区块链技术的迅猛发展,许多企业和个人用户开始使用加密货币进行交易和投资。在这一趋势下,资产管理的需求日渐增加,尤其是批量转账的需求。Tokenim作为一种极具潜力的工具,可以帮助用户轻松实现批量转账,提升工作效率。但是,要实现这一功能,就需要编写一个我们称之为“Tokenim批量转账脚本”的程序。本文将详细探讨如何编写和使用Tokenim批量转账脚本,以及它的相关知识和注意事项。
Tokenim批量转账脚本是一种用于自动化转账过程的程序,能够帮助用户一次性发送多笔交易,而无须手动逐一操作。这种脚本通常是用编程语言编写的,比如Python或JavaScript,可以通过API与区块链网络进行交互,从而实现批量转账的目标。
使用Tokenim批量转账脚本的主要好处在于提高效能和减少人为错误。尤其在处理大量交易时,手动转账既耗时又容易出错,使用脚本可以有效规避这些问题,并提高资产管理的安全性和效率。
Tokenim批量转账脚本的基本结构一般包括以下几个主要组成部分:
编写Tokenim批量转账脚本需要一定的编程基础,我们以Python为例,简单介绍一下基础步骤:
首先,需要确保Python环境已经安装,并安装相关库,如web3.py来与以太坊网络交互。
接下来,需要设置钱包地址和私钥。私钥一定要安全存储,避免泄露。
利用pandas库读取CSV文件,获取收款地址和金额,并进行格式化处理,以便后续转账操作。
使用web3.py库与以太坊区块链进行交互,通过循环遍历每一笔交易,调用相应API进行转账处理,并记录状态。
在转账过程中,要做好异常处理,记录失败的转账以及相应的错误信息,以便于后续解决。
在使用和编写Tokenim批量转账脚本时,有几个方面需要特别注意:
以下是与Tokenim批量转账脚本相关的五个常见问题,我们将逐一详细解答。
保障Tokenim批量转账脚本的安全性是非常重要的,关键在于私钥管理、代码审计和环境安全等方面。使用环境变量来存储私钥,不要将其写进代码中。使用版本控制系统时,也要忽略包含私钥的文件,避免意外泄露。
此外,应定期审计自己的代码,确保没有潜在的安全漏洞。同时,使用防火墙和监测工具来实时监控是否有人试图访问你的系统。一旦发现异常活动,必须立即采取措施。
Tokenim批量转账脚本的设计通常是针对特定区块链的,比如以太坊、波卡等。不同区块链的API和交互机制有所不同,因此,需要针对不同区块链改写相应的脚本。例如,如果你想在波卡上实现批量转账,就需要使用波卡的相关库和API。
为了实现跨链操作,还可以考虑使用中介者,比如跨链钱包或去中心化交易所,但其复杂性会大大增加。
处理批量转账中的失败交易时,可以采取以下几步:
是的,使用Tokenim批量转账脚本进行转账时,需要支付相应的交易费用。费用的高低取决于网络的繁忙程度、gas 价格等因素。通常情况下,批量转账的交易费用会比单笔转账的费用高,因为每一笔交易都需要占用链上的资源。
因此,在使用批量转账脚本之前,用户应确保钱包中有足够的资金来覆盖这些费用,以免因资金不足导致转账失败。
要Tokenim批量转账脚本的执行效率,可以考虑以下几个方面:
总结来看,Tokenim批量转账脚本为用户提供了高效、安全的资产管理方式。通过合理的设计和实施,可以有效提高加密货币转账的效率,同时也能保障资金的安全性。希望本文能为你更好地理解和使用Tokenim批量转账脚本提供帮助。
leave a reply